The Majesty of Sotará Volcano
Dominating the landscape, Sotará Volcano is a breathtaking sight. While climbing to the summit might be challenging, simply admiring its imposing presence from afar is an unforgettable experience. The surrounding area offers incredible hiking opportunities with stunning panoramic views.
Exploring the Coffee Plantations
Colombia is renowned for its coffee, and Sotara is no exception. Take a tour of a local coffee plantation, learn about the process from bean to cup, and savour the rich flavour of freshly brewed Colombian coffee. It's a truly immersive experience.
The Charm of Paéz Villages
Immerse yourself in the unique culture of the Paéz indigenous community. These villages offer a glimpse into a way of life that has remained largely unchanged for centuries. Respectful observation and interaction will leave you with a deeper understanding of Colombian heritage.

Best Time to Visit Sotara, Colombia
The best time to visit is during the dry season (typically December to March). However, the region is beautiful year-round, and each season offers a unique charm. Be prepared for varied weather conditions, even within a single day.
